Man arrested after his fake robbery story raises cops’ brows

The accused has been identified as Amit Sharma who was later arrested. A BBA dropout, Sharma did his schooling from Modern School in Noida and was employed with a footwear firm for some time. Meanwhile, police have recovered the entire amount of Rs 30 lakh from the accused’s possession.
According to the police, on June 22, Sharma, employee in a private footwear firm based in New Friends Colony reported that while he was coming on motorcycle from Sagar Apartments near Tilak Marg, unidentified men in Maruti Swift Dzire car intercepted him and robbed him of Rs 30 lakh which he was carrying in a backpack. His employer, Prashant Modi had asked him to take the amount of cash from the concerned person.
“He told us that he took a U-turn from Bhagwandass crossing and when he was about to reach Patiala House Court, unidentified men in Swift Dzire car waylaid him and one of them forcibly snatched bag containing Rs 30 lakh from him,” said Jatin Narwal, Deputy Commissioner of Police, (New Delhi).
Based on his complaint, police registered a case.
“When Amit was questioned, police was not convinced with his version. Moreover, police cross checked the CCTV footage of the area and took out the Call Detail Records of Amit and other employees of the footwear firm. Cops found that no such robbery incident took place during the said time of June 22, said a senior police official.
“It was only when he was extensively questioned that Amit broke down and disclosed that he staged a fake robbery and had misappropriated the amount,” said the DCP. A case under relevant sections of the IPC has been registered against the accused at the Tilak Marg police station. Further investigation is on.
